DTW Challenge
Design a small towed grader that can be used in labour- intensive road maintenance operations in Cambodia and other developing countries. Construct and test a prototype, supply three sample machines, and evaluate their functionality and robustness.

Result

DTW designed and manufactured the Cam-Grader as a low-cost road grader to be towed by a tractor.   It has no mechanical gearing nor hydraulics.  It is capable of being easily repaired and can be manufactured at low-cost by any reasonably equipped workshop. 

In addition to its simplicity, another remarkable feature of the Cam-Grader is its use of recycled parts.  These include its wheels, a car mechanism arrangement for lowering the blade, and a standard car disc brake assembly used for holding the blade in operational position.
